How to Choose a Cheap and High-Quality Kitchen Sink
The most affordable sinks today are stainless steel as well as pressed steel. The reduced price stainless and also journalism steel are also known as "house" grade. They call them this since apartment or condo proprietors, looking for the least expensive rates have a tendency to use these items. If you're on a budget plan and your household are not hefty users of the kitchen area sink, these might be an eye-catching choice to extra costly products. Realize though that journalism steel sink commonly has actually a repainted surface that damages and chips easily. These sinks will certainly often tend to look old and out-of-date quickly as a result of the surface utilized. The stainless also scratches conveniently however if cared for correctly, it will certainly remain to look acceptable. Less costly stainless steel sinks have a tendency to be made of thinner material which suggests that water being ran into them as well as the waste disposal unit will seem a whole lot louder on these less expensive models. These sinks are available in rimless and also leading placed versions.

A certain upgrade to these products is the cast iron kitchen sink. These sinks are made of casted steel them completed with a porcelain material providing a deep and lovely radiance. The surface is long putting on as well as with a little periodic shaving, can look wonderful for several years. They can be found in a range of shades as well as can be ordered in undercounter mounting or leading placing designs. These cooking area sinks however are hefty and also much more difficult to mount so unless you are exceptionally useful and also have experience with these sinks, you will need a specialist for installation.

An additional sink product that appears to be acquiring in popularity is the solid surface area type material These are a resilient material created right into a cooking area sink as well as tend to be even more of a matte coating. This type of sink material goes especially well with more natural coatings in your cooking area. Although not as preferred as cast-iron, these composite cooking area sinks are quickly getting a solid following.

HOW DO YOU CHOOSE THE BEST UNDERMOUNT KITCHEN SINK?


Consider your sink's dimension


The size of your sink is something you must consider. If you have a smaller kitchen, you may want a smaller sink. However, if your kitchen is spacious, a larger sink is a better choice. The depth and width of your sink will also matter when determining which one is best for your home.


Decide on the right material


Undermount kitchen sinks are typically made from stainless steel, copper, or cast iron. Stainless steel is a popular choice because it is durable and easy to clean. Copper sinks can be expensive, but they are attractive and give your kitchen a classic look. Cast iron sinks are usually cheaper than copper, but they have a shorter lifespan and require more maintenance.


Determine the number of bowls you need


The choice between single bowl, double bowl, or triple bowl sinks is a matter of personal preference, but there are some other factors that might influence your decision. If you have limited counter space, you might want to consider a single-bowl sink in order to maximize your work area. However, if you have ample space or want to do large dishes then it's ideal to go for double or triple bowl sinks.
